dc.description.abstractHigh productivity during the skidding stage can reduce production costs in timber harvesting activities, thereby increasing and optimizing the utilization of timber forest products. This research was conducted using a quantitative approach, with direct recording of the skidded timber volume, skidding distance, and skidding work time. Data analysis used multiple linear regression to determine the influence of two independent variables volume and skidding distance on skidding productivity. The results showed that both skidding volume and distance had a significant effect on productivity, with an R² value of 0.889, indicating that 88.9 % of the variation in productivity could be explained by these two variables. The highest skidding cost was recorded at IDR 17.540/m³ in compartment D083 plot 2, while the lowest cost was IDR 12.693/m³ in compartment D136 plot 1. Therefore, increasing productivity through the optimization of skidding volume and management of skidding distance can reduce skidding costs.en_US
